BMW Group has decided to invest 400 million Euros in developing a new assembly line in Munich which will be dedicated to electric cars. Also, the German group has come up with new logistic things.

One of them is about the next generation Mini Countryman. According to BMW Group, the new model will be produced starting in 2023 and it will be made in Germany. This will be the first Mini assembled in Germany and it will come to life in Leipzig.

Also, the German group come up with new things regarding the British SUV. It will have combustion engine versions, but it will also be available in an all electric variant.
